Hi there. New to Reddit. But need advice on a situation involving Crypto & Employer.

So I am being offered a remote position in my province only. Things look okayish but a few things put me off. First, they provided me with their Canadian Business Number with which I couldn't find the company. However, when I randomly copied and pasted that nub on Google search, the first result was about the company from a website called Canadian Business Directory. But when I tried to search for the same company manually in this directory, no result came up.

Secondly, HR told me to provide some bank details - except for the bank account nub like bank name, holder name, email etc. to transfer my salary via e-transfer or direct deposit whichever I prefer. But they also said that I would be making purchase transactions for their clients using Bitcoin - which the company will provide me via a personal Bitcoin wallet.

for bg info: I live in Canada. The employer company is registered in the same province where I live but not the same city. I am a newcomer to Canada hence have no idea how much legality Bitcoin holds.

Also, I am absolutely a novice to BITCOIN.

So experts, please tell me, is there anything fishy here? Is it normal practice when it comes to Bitcoin? Shall I provide my bank details?
